According to reports, the exchange rate for a dollar to Naira at Lagos Parallel Market (Black Market) stood at N1485 for buying and N1490 for selling on Friday, February 9th, 2024. These figures, sourced from Bureau De Change (BDC) outlets, shed light on the ongoing dynamics within the currency exchange landscape.

However, it’s crucial to note that the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) maintains its stance against the parallel market, emphasizing the importance of official banking channels for forex transactions.

While the black market offers insights into informal currency trading, recent developments in the forex market paint a broader picture of economic activity. The Nigerian Autonomous Foreign Exchange Market (NAFEM) witnessed a notable decline in forex transactions, signaling a 56 percent drop in total value from Tuesday to Wednesday, as reported by the FMDQ Exchange.

Despite efforts by the CBN to bolster market liquidity and stabilize exchange rates, the naira experienced a 1.4 percent depreciation against the dollar at the parallel market on Thursday. This decline, coupled with robust demand for the US currency, underscores the challenges faced in maintaining currency stability amidst fluctuating market conditions.
